
Operating Accessory Devices with the TV Remote
Once you have programmed your TV remote, refer to page 27 to see how the remote func- tions with accessory devices.
Before the remote will operate an accessory device, you must select the correct mode: CBL (cable box), VCR, DVD, SAT (satellite), or AMP (amplifier).
1 Press the Select button to cycle through the accessory modes. When the mode you want lights up, stop pressing the button. After a few seconds, the light will begin blinking. The blinking means that the remote is in the acces- sory mode you have selected.

2 Point the front of the remote toward the front of the accessory device, then press the button to perform the desired function.
HELPFUL HINT
●Press the Select button once to return the remote to the TV mode.
●Press the Select Button twice to select another device by cycling through the accessory mode choices.

To backlight the remote control but-
tons, press and hold the Select button for
two seconds. If you do not press any remote buttons for five sec- onds, the backlight switches off.
